Output 83697ec0763f23a1cc09ff7e62bde412b488bb3fd22b32fc7eb558020c505528:3

value
1465913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db15578bc1fa778c9329fbed1e08aa30e9a66f5c OP_EQUAL
address
3MfRURNv4WjacFuNWMuhVdEk9dQfXyNsHF
transaction
83697ec0763f23a1cc09ff7e62bde412b488bb3fd22b32fc7eb558020c505528
spent
true